TRACCS, the region’s leading independent communications consultancy, has partnered with Ainigma, a London-based boutique AI advisory, to promote human-centred innovation and accelerate Generative AI (GenAI) adoption across the Middle East. This collaboration seeks to redefine how organisations harness AI to enhance creativity, efficiency, and growth responsibly.
The partnership, announced during Athar – Saudi Festival of Creativity, merges TRACCS’ established communications acumen with Ainigma’s expertise in ethical and strategic AI deployment. Their joint mission is to help organisations unlock new opportunities, elevate performance, and shape a future-ready digital landscape through practical, people-first AI solutions.
Globally, AI has become a key driver of economic expansion. McKinsey projects that GenAI alone could inject between USD 2.6 trillion and USD 4.4 trillion annually into the world economy. In the Middle East, PwC expects AI to contribute as much as USD 320 billion to the region’s GDP by 2030, while Google’s 2024 Economic Impact Report forecasts a potential boost of over USD 193 billion to Saudi Arabia’s economy and more than USD 80 billion to the UAE’s.
